Transform From Concept to Creation: The Workflow of a Designer

A designer's process is a fascinating synthesis of creativity and strategy. It all initiates with a spark, an idea, a inspiration that sets the stage for a compelling piece. From there, the designer sets out on a structured process to refine this initial concept into a tangible creation.

  • Ideation: This initial phase involves generating ideas, analyzing target audiences, and establishing the core message of the design.
  • Visualization: Basic sketches and digital prototypes come to life, allowing the designer to experiment with different solutions.
  • Refinement: Once a direction is chosen, the design evolves through multiple rounds, each containing detailed implementation
  • Presentation: The final version is presented with clients or stakeholders, soliciting feedback and guiding further refinements

In essence, the designer's workflow is a dynamic and ongoing process that results in a polished creation that effectively transmits its intended concept

The Evolution of Design: Trends Shaping the Future

Design is a dynamic field, regularly redefining itself to reflect the fluctuating needs and desires of society. As we move into the future, several key trends are poised to shape the landscape of design, driving creativity to new heights. One notable trend is the increasing priority on environmental responsibility in design.

Audiences are expecting more ethical products and services, encouraging designers to implement eco-friendly practices at every stage of the design process.

  • Another significant trend is the growth of AI-powered design tools. These tools facilitate designers to automate tasks, freeing them up to devote on more creative aspects of their work.
  • Additionally, we are seeing a shift towards more tailored design experiences. Developments in technology, such as machine learning, allow designers to acquire valuable data about user preferences and tendencies.

This enables them to design products and services that are precisely suited to the individual needs of each customer. As these trends evolve, the future of design promises to be exciting, with designers playing an expanding role in influencing our world.
